    About the Book

    Edit

    Winter is Coming is a book I wrote, in 2003, predicting the economic crash in 2008. What follows is the original Abstract for the book.



    Winter is coming, tells the story of a crisis era called Winter. This crisis is just a few short years away. The work in this book is based on two generational theorists, William Strauss and Neil Howe. The book also includes economist Harry S. Dent's work.



    You'll want to read this book if you want to know, why and who is forcing the coming crisis. How the crisis era cycles through American History arrive like clockwork, yet, they shock everyone when they come

    Learn how reoccurring financial, war, generational, and political cycles contribute to our history and shape our future.



    Learn:

    --How 'America's Greatest Generation' -ripped you off.

    --Why 'boomers suck'.

    --Why, approximately every 85 years, the generations line up in specific age location that set the stage for the Winter era.



    Winter is Coming is short, concise and a great introduction to the brilliant work of William Strauss and Neil Howe.
